2003-04-25 Havoc Pennington <hp@redhat.com>
authorHavoc Pennington <hp@redhat.com>
Fri, 25 Apr 2003 23:50:34 +0000 (23:50 +0000)
committerHavoc Pennington <hp@redhat.com>
Fri, 25 Apr 2003 23:50:34 +0000 (23:50 +0000)
commitb3bd48edfc1aab0a9dc64bfa4c380d845d218e73
tree0ba9466c0b457769e9aa890906da532d875aac43
parent4b87aa40dfba668f8622873f2ea420b098704e41
2003-04-25  Havoc Pennington  <hp@redhat.com>

        test suite is slightly hosed at the moment, will fix soon

* bus/connection.c (bus_connections_expire_incomplete): fix to
properly disable the timeout when required
(bus_connection_set_name): check whether we can remove incomplete
connections timeout after we complete each connection.

* dbus/dbus-mainloop.c (check_timeout): fix this up a bit,
probably still broken.

* bus/services.c (bus_registry_acquire_service): implement max
number of services owned, and honor allow/deny rules on which
services a connection can own.

* bus/connection.c (bus_connection_get_policy): report errors here

* bus/activation.c: implement limit on number of pending
activations
13 files changed:
ChangeLog
bus/activation.c
bus/bus.c
bus/bus.h
bus/config-parser.c
bus/connection.c
bus/connection.h
bus/driver.c
bus/services.c
dbus/dbus-mainloop.c
dbus/dbus-timeout.c
doc/config-file.txt
test/data/valid-config-files/basic.conf